Filmish: A Graphic Journey Through Film by Edward Ross is an illustrated exploration of cinema as both an art form and a cultural force. Using graphic storytelling, diagrams, and visual metaphors, Ross traces how film language developed and how cinema reflects and shapes politics, technology, ideology, and society.
Rather than a collection of reviews, Filmish functions as accessible film theory, examining why movies look the way they do, how genres evolve, and how power, surveillance, futurism, and dystopia recur across film history. References range from early cinema and classic Hollywood through to science fiction, animation, and modern blockbusters.
Published by SelfMadeHero, this title is widely used by film students, educators, and cinephiles, and is frequently stocked by art bookshops, museum stores, and university libraries.
